Todd Bowles Says Bucs Have Toughness Problems

October 19th, 2022

Todd Bowles

Todd Bowles had a little pain in his voice last night, perhaps similar to the pain in the guts of Bucs fans on Sunday.

Tampa Bay has been poor on short yardage and often that’s about fire and heart and toughness. In the case of the Bucs, Bowles sure thinks it is.

In fact, Bowles said on the Buccaneers Radio Network that he doesn’t want to see playcaller Byron Leftwich start devising a bunch of new plays for short yardage. Instead, Bowles wants the resident tough guys to man up.

“We were bad on 3rd-and-short, even 3rd-and-inches, 3rd-and-1; we gotta find a way to get one yard,” Bowles said. “We got some tough guys up there. We gotta understand what we are and who we are going forward, as opposed to trying to make a whole bunch of different plays, and we gotta be better at that. … We gotta be tougher up front. We gotta be tougher up front on both side of the ball. Plain and simple.”

What is a little ironic and sad is that making the Bucs a tougher-than-last-year football team was one of Bowles’ offseason goals.

Perhaps this is the week the Bucs collectively turn the corner in the tough guy department.
